22 students earned Other Human Development, Family Studies, & Related Services degrees in Washington in the 2022-2023 year.

Other Human Development, Family Studies, & Related Services majors in the state tend to have the following degree levels:

Education Level Number of Grads
Award Taking Less Than 1 Year 22

Racial Distribution

The racial distribution of other human development, family studies, & related services majors in Washington is as follows:

  • Asian: 4.5%
  • Black or African American: 0.0%
  • Hispanic or Latino: 13.6%
  • White: 68.2%
  • Non-Resident Alien: 4.5%
  • Other Races: 9.1%
